They'd often use the GIM even while playing cribbage, rather than use the chat area on the game site. The options were better on GIM, and the ability to share files in various formats just wasn't being done yet on gaming chat areas. Doubtful it ever would, as most people prefered to use their own IMs for privacy reasons anyways.

Mitch watched her thinking about her six cards. He could always tell when she had a hard hand to split up, because normally she selected the two crib cards within five seconds. Anything over that time frame meant she had a difficult decision to make, or a hand that wasn't easily read. These were the ones she'd jot down the cards to ask him about after the round. More often than not she selected the same split he would have, but there were occasional strategy and playing of the odds she missed.

There was something about looking at Elizabeth and eating bread, Mitch thought to himself, that almost drove him out of his mind. The soft texture of the middle, when it hit his lips, if he looked at her at the same time it would give him an instant erection. He put the bread down and tried to concentrate on the game, a strange sense of guilt rolling over him. Or shame. He wasn't sure which, he'd done nothing wrong, logically. It was normal to think these types of thoughts about women. For some reason, though, with her he felt almost as if he shouldn't or he'd lose her. Which, he suddenly realized, was bullshit. He wasn't sure what he was projecting onto her, but there was no reason to believe Elizabeth was not interested in sex. She was a young woman in her 20s, she must have thoughts about it. Maybe she was just like him? Somewhat focussed on other life stuff, but the sex thoughts just floating on the surface and easily stirred?
